About The Role
The Document Controls Specialist supports the PMO by managing, maintaining, and enforcing document control processes across power delivery projects, including Transmission, Distribution, Substation, and Grid Infrastructure Programs. This role ensures project documentation is accurate, complete, properly versioned, compliant with internal standards, and readily accessible to project teams, clients, and external stakeholders throughout the project lifecycle.
Key Responsibilities
Document Management
- Develop, implement, and maintain document control procedures and systems
- Manage the intake, processing, storage, retrieval, and distribution of documents
- Ensure all documents are accurate, complete, and properly version-controlled
- Maintain document logs, registers, and tracking systems
- Ensure compliance with internal standards, industry regulations, and audit requirements
- Conduct regular document audits to verify accuracy and completeness
- Support internal and external audits by providing required documentation
Version Control & Change Management
- Monitor document revisions and ensure proper version control practices
- Track changes and maintain historical records of document updates
- Archive obsolete documents in accordance with retention policies
- Coordinate document flow between project teams, vendors, and stakeholders
- Support project documentation processes (e.g., engineering drawings, contracts, reports)
- Ensure timely distribution of documents to relevant stakeholders
Systems & Tools
- Administer and maintain document management systems (e.g., SharePoint, Aconex, EDMS)
- Train team members on document control procedures and tools
- Generate reports on document status, compliance, and workflows
- 2 years of experience in document control, records management, or similar role
- Proficiency with document management systems and Microsoft Office (especially Excel and SharePoint)
- Strong attention to detail and organizational skills
